Deze stijlvolle tafellamp in boogdesign van massief mangohout is een echte sfeermaker op je dressoir, nachtkastje of bijzettafel. De organische vorm met open houten boog zorgt voor een speels en warm lichteffect, waardoor de lamp perfect past in een modern, Scandinavisch, landelijk of industrieel interieur. Dankzij het compacte formaat van 30 bij 13 centimeter plaats je dit artikel gemakkelijk op kleinere oppervlaktes, terwijl de hoogte van 43 centimeter genoeg aanwezigheid geeft. In combinatie met een mooie LED filament lichtbron creëer je met deze tafellamp een gezellige, uitnodigende sfeer in elke ruimte.Specificaties
- Materiaal: massief mangohout
- Kleur: massief mango naturel
- Afmetingen: lengte 30 cm, breedte 13 cm, hoogte 43 cm
- Fitting: E27 (geschikt voor LED lichtbron)
- Aanbevolen lichtbron: LED G125 filament bol Ø12,5 – E27
- Bediening: knop op het snoer
- Beschermingsklasse: IP20 (voor gebruik binnenshuis)
- Certificering: CE en CB
- Serie: Celia
Warm licht en decoratief design in één
Met deze houten tafellamp haal je een combinatie van sfeerverlichting en decoratie in huis. De boogvorm met uitsparing waarin je de lichtbron plaatst, zorgt ervoor dat het licht subtiel langs het mangohout strijkt. Daardoor ontstaat een warme gloed die direct gezelligheid toevoegt aan je woon- of slaapkamer. Door te kiezen voor een LED filament bol met zichtbare gloeidraden leg je extra nadruk op het design van de lamp. De open constructie voorkomt harde schaduwen en verspreidt het licht gelijkmatig in de ruimte. Bovendien maakt het natuurlijke karakter van mangohout elke lamp uniek. De nerven, kleurschakeringen en kleine oneffenheden geven dit artikel een ambachtelijke uitstraling die je interieur net dat beetje extra karakter geeft.Massief mangohout als blikvanger
Het gebruik van massief mangohout geeft deze tafellamp een robuuste en tegelijk warme uitstraling. Mangohout staat bekend om zijn sterke, duurzame karakter en opvallende tekening. Daardoor komt de boogvorm van het ontwerp extra goed tot zijn recht. De natuurlijke kleur laat zich eenvoudig combineren met andere materialen zoals metaal, linnen of glas. Zo past deze gadget moeiteloos bij je bestaande meubelen en accessoires. Zet de lamp bijvoorbeeld naast een bank met een stoffen bekleding, op een houten sidetable of op een minimalistisch bureau. Door de compacte voet heb je weinig ruimte nodig, terwijl de hoogte ervoor zorgt dat de lichtbron duidelijk zichtbaar blijft en het geheel een echte eyecatcher wordt in je woonruimte.Praktisch in gebruik en makkelijk te combineren
Naast het decoratieve ontwerp is deze tafellamp ook praktisch in het dagelijks gebruik. Dankzij de knop op het snoer schakel je de verlichting eenvoudig aan en uit, zonder dat je hoeft te reiken naar een schakelaar elders in de kamer. De E27 fitting maakt het mogelijk verschillende soorten LED lichtbronnen te gebruiken, zodat je zelf bepaalt hoeveel licht en welke kleurtemperatuur je prettig vindt. Gebruik een warme LED voor sfeer in de avond of een neutralere toon voor een bureau of werkhoek. Door het tijdloze design combineer je dit artikel makkelijk met andere lampen in huis, zoals staande lampen of hanglampen met houten details.
